91 ## Which host architecture to use for foreign architectures.  It turns out
92 ## that it's best to use a Qemu with the same host bitness as the target
93 ## architecture; otherwise it has to do a difficult job of converting
94 ## arguments and results between kernel ABI flavours.
95 32BIT_QEMUHOST           = $(or $(filter i386,$(NATIVE_ARCHS)),$(TOOLSARCH))
96 64BIT_QEMUHOST           = $(or $(filter amd64,$(NATIVE_ARCHS)),$(TOOLSARCH))
97
98 CONFIG_VARS             += $(foreach a,$(FOREIGN_ARCHS), $a_QEMUHOST)
99 armel_QEMUHOST           = $(32BIT_QEMUHOST)
100 armhf_QEMUHOST           = $(32BIT_QEMUHOST)
101 arm64_QEMUHOST           = $(64BIT_QEMUHOST)
102 i386_QEMUHOST            = $(32BIT_QEMUHOST)
103 amd64_QEMUHOST           = $(64BIT_QEMUHOST)
